Wollongong duo Chimers is hitting the road in Australia, in support of their new album “Through Today”, which is out on November 8 on Poison City Records in Australia and 12XU in North America.
It’s the second album for husband-and-wife Padraic and Binx following their self-titled debut in 2021 and they’ll play their own shows in four states and as special guests to Party Dozen (Sydney in October) and The Saints ’73-’78 (in November).
The new record is said to be laced with traces of late-‘80s post-hardcore and alterna-sounds (Fugazi, Sonic Youth, Hüsker Dü) delivered in Chimers' direct and no-unnecessary-fills approach.
Recorded and mixed by Jonathan Boulet (Party Dozen, Body Type, Loose Fit) “Through Today” is said to be a significant leap forward. Special guests include Kirsty Tickle from Party Dozen and Jordan Ireland from ARIA-award nominated and AMP winners, The Middle East.
